BUG/MEDIUM: contrib/mod_defender: Use network order to encode/decode flags

A recent fix on the SPOE revealed a mismatch between the SPOE specification and
the mod_defender implementation on the way flags are encoded or decoded. They
must be exchanged using the network bytes order and not the host one.

Be careful though, this patch breaks the compatiblity with HAProxy SPOE before
commit c4dcaff3 ("BUG/MEDIUM: spoe: Flags are not encoded in network order").
